The Sample Job Offer Letter with Probation Period in Travis is a formal document used by employers to extend a job offer to a selected candidate while outlining the terms of employment, including a probationary period. This letter serves to reconfirm previously discussed agreements regarding the job position, salary, and responsibilities. It is essential for employers to personalize the template by including specific details such as the job title, department, and annual salary, ensuring clarity about job duties and expectations. Tips to write a Confirmation Letter in a professional tone: Use a formal tone and language throughout the letter. Clearly state the details of the agreement or arrangement being confirmed. Include relevant dates, times, and locations. Provide contact information in case the recipient has any questions or concerns.

What to include in a job offer letter 1 Welcome message. A welcome message may be included at the beginning of the letter to congratulate the candidate on being offered the new position. 2 Job title. 3 Salary and compensation. 4 Start date. 5 Employment type. 6 Work schedule. 7 Reporting structure. 8 Terms and conditions.
